ಸತ್ಯ
♪ satya 🔊- :
-
true; real; actual; genuine.
-
honest; truthful.
-
pure; virtuous.
-
good; right; proper.
-
ಸತ್ಯ
♪ satya 🔊- :Noun
-
the quality or fact of being real; reality.
-
habitual truthfulness; speaking the truth; sincerity; veracity.
-
a law, rule or other order prescribed by authority, esp. to regulate conduct; a regulation.
-
the abode of Brahma, the uppermost of the seven worlds.
-
a solemn pledge (to oneself or to another or to a deity) to do something or to behave in a certain manner; a vow.
-
the first of the four mythological divisions of the age; Křtayuga (a duration of 17,28,000 years).
-
the quality of goodness or purity or knowledge (as the fundamental principle of Brahma).
-
a truthful, honest, veracious man.
-
(jain.) one of the ten basic qualities of the Soul, the immortal entity of all beings.
-
veraciousness or being habitually truthful, as one of the five principles a householder has to observe.
-
ಸತ್ಯವಿದ್ದರೆ ಎತ್ತಲೂ ಭಯವಿಲ್ಲ satyaviddare ettalū bhayavilla (prov.) truth ever conquers.
